Answer:
Each Acre costs $16,825
60 acres would cost $1,009,500
Step-by-step explanation:
To find the cost of each acre, divide the total cost (673,000) by the number of acres being bought (40)
You're answer is the price of one acre therefore, to find the cost for 60 acres, multiply the price of one acre (16,825) by 60.
